Getting There

  • Car

    If you are driving to Mesnes Park, Wigan, take the M6 motorway and exit at Junction 26 for the A577 towards Wigan. Follow the A577, which becomes the A49. Continue straight onto the A49 and follow the signs for Wigan Town Centre. Once you reach the town centre, look for signs directing you to Mesnes Park. There is parking available nearby; however, be aware that parking may incur a fee. The park's address is Mesnes Park Terrace, Wigan WN1 1TU.

  • Train

    To reach Mesnes Park by train, take a train to Wigan North Western station, which is well connected from major cities in North West England. From the station, it is approximately a 15-minute walk to the park. Exit the station and head southeast on Station Road. Continue straight, then turn left onto Mesnes Street, which leads directly to the park entrance. This journey is free of additional transportation costs beyond your train fare.

  • Bus

    If you prefer to travel by bus, several local bus services operate to Wigan Town Centre. Look for services that stop at Wigan Bus Station. Once you arrive at the bus station, Mesnes Park is a short walk away. Exit the bus station and head east on Market Street, then turn left onto Mesnes Street. The park will be on your right. Bus fares may vary, so check with the local bus service for exact prices.

  • Taxi

    For a more direct and convenient option, consider taking a taxi to Mesnes Park. Taxis are readily available in Wigan and can provide door-to-door service. Simply provide the driver with the address: Mesnes Park Terrace, Wigan WN1 1TU. Taxi fares will vary based on your starting location and time of day.

Discover more about Mesnes Park, Wigan

Mesnes Park, a gem in the heart of Wigan, beckons visitors with its enchanting landscape and serene ambiance. This beautifully landscaped park is perfect for those looking to unwind while surrounded by nature. Spanning several acres, the park features lush gardens, winding pathways, and tranquil ponds that invite visitors to take leisurely strolls or simply sit and enjoy the peaceful scenery. Families will find ample space for picnicking, playing games, or simply soaking up the sun. The children's play area is particularly popular, providing a safe and fun environment for younger visitors. In addition to its natural beauty, Mesnes Park boasts a variety of recreational facilities, including tennis courts and sports fields, ensuring that there's something for everyone. The park is also home to several historical monuments and sculptures, offering a glimpse into the local heritage. Throughout the year, the park hosts various events and activities, making it a vibrant hub for community engagement. Whether you're a local or a tourist, Mesnes Park provides a welcoming atmosphere to relax, connect with nature, and enjoy the tranquillity that Wigan has to offer.
